Rain/Light Recognition Sensor, Servicing (Manufacturer TRW)
Only TRW can replace the housing and optical unit if the optical unit (coupling cushion) is damaged.
There are different housings for the rain sensors because there are multiple manufacturers.
A replacement rain sensor housing and optical unit are always delivered with mounting clips. Remove these clips if they are not needed.
Perform the following
- Remove the rain sensor. Refer to => [ Removal ] Rain/Light Recognition Sensor (G397).
Manufacturer TRW
The rain sensor electronics may be damaged.
Be careful not to insert the screwdriver all the way through the housing up to the rain sensor electronics.
Do not touch the rain sensor electronics.
- Press the tab - 2 - on both sides and separate the upper section - 1 - from the lower section - 3 -.
- Remove the rain sensor electronics - 4 - from the old lower section and install the new electronics the exact same way.
Do not touch the optical unit.
Remove the protective cover from the rain sensor just before installing it.
- Assemble the new upper section with optical unit and protective cover and the lower section.
- Pry the clip and bracket - 1 - out of the rain sensor housing - 2 - with a screwdriver.
- Install the rain sensor. Refer to => [ Installation ] Rain/Light Recognition Sensor (G397).
